PRESCHOOL TEACHER
Providence seeks preschool teachers who will be responsible for providing a safe, engaging, and developmentally-appropriate classroom and outdoor preschool experience, aligned with Providence’s commitment to incorporate Christian values in the learning process. The teacher will establish routines, provide positive guidance, and facilitate creative learning activities to meet the social, emotional, cognitive, and physical needs of young children (2.5–5 years old).
Lead teacher candidates will have at least 12 units in early childhood education from an accredited college. A minimum of 6 units is required for assistant teachers. Ideal candidates should demonstrate excellent communication skills with students, their parents, and members of the community.

DIRECTOR OF FINANCE & OPERATIONS
The Director of Finance and Operations will serve to advance the mission of Providence School, in close collaboration with the Head of School, by managing the annual budgeting process, including tuition and salary planning, monitoring and forecasting operating results, overseeing payroll and benefit plans and the school’s financial policies. S/he is responsible for ensuring the organization follows sound accounting practices through internal controls, filing tax returns, and other government forms, and managing the school’s AP, AR, cash flow, investment accounts, and banking relationships.
The Director of Finance and Operations will also provide the Head of School and the Board of Directors accurate and timely financial reports and insight on a regular basis while maintaining accurate financial and HR-related records in compliance with government regulations and internal policies. S/he is responsible for assessing and overseeing risk management and the general health and safety of the workforce.
As a member of the Administrative Leadership Team, s/he will collaborate with the Head of School and other senior administrative staff in managing the need-based tuition assistance program of the school.
